About 7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id
7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id (PubChem CID 122573980) has the molecular formula C19H18FNO3
and a molecular weight of 327.36 g/mol. Its IUPAC name is 7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id.

What is the SMILES notation for 7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id?
The canonical SMILES for 7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id is Cc1cc(-c2cc(C(C)(C)C)c3oc(C(=O)O)cc3n2)ccc1F.
What is the InChIKey of 7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id?
The InChIKey is JCJXBZYSEUVATH-UHFFFAOYSA-N. The full InChI is InChI=1S/C19H18FNO3/c1-10-7-11(5-6-13(10)20)14-8-12(19(2,3)4)17-15(21-14)9-16(24-17)18(22)23/h5-9H,1-4H3,(H,22,23).
What are the key properties of 7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id?
7-tert-butyl-5-(4-fluoro-3-methylphenyl)furo[3,2-b]pyridine-2-carboxylic acid has a molecular weight of 327.36 g/mol, XLogP of 4.94, 2 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
